Soldiers get ‘coined’ by ISAF commander at Spin Boldak

Marine Gen. John R. Allen, commander of the International Security Assistance Force, presents his coin to Spc. Victor M. Ley of Alpha Company of the 1st Battalion, 17th Infantry Regiment, 2nd Infantry Division, during a command visit at Forward Operating Base Spin Boldak, Afghanistan, July 12, 2012. Ley, from San Diego, received the recognition for his efforts as the lead vehicle driver for his platoon during Operation Buffalo Thunder II.
